I keep leaning towards a TD system. Like a TSP clone, but instead using 2.5" X, same magnaflow bullet that I am using for my magnamouth (just would buy another bullet) and dump them like so. Found a user on ls1tech that uses the exact same set up I would like, but they are using 3"
Went through a alot of TD topics on ls1tech and ls1.com and many users listed using universal xpipes, but did not list which one they purchased... while others had one custom made. I searched around on summit,jegs,lmperformance..etc...etc.
A couple xpipes that I found listed under universal are as followed for 2.5"
Pypes Off-Road X-Pipes XVF10
Summit Racing® Universal X-Pipe Kits SUM-642125
Pypes Off-Road X-Pipes XVA10
Pypes Off-Road X-Pipes XVF13
Would one of these be more beneficial than the other? I know some massaging and cutting will have to take place with a universal which is fine.
